python 基础系统函数

python 有六种数据对象 NUMBER、STRING、LIST、TUPLE、SET、DICTIONARY

# 查看 系统模块

import sys

sys.modules.keys()

注释: 可以把系统模块 IMPORT 然后使用DIR函数 ,就可以知道里面有多少个 方法.

# 查看python 系统函数

import  builtins

dir(builtins)

# 查看已经安装的模块 , 有点类似于PHP 语言的 phpinfo()

help('modules')

# 监听输入

str() // 字符型

input() // 输入框

print() // 输出 输入框中的信息

# 字符串转换 , python 变量申请  不用 写关键字 说明是变量 如 var、let  、const等, 直接赋值就好

num = input('xxxx input 标签')

print(type(num))

# 类型转换

# 函数声明

num = 3.1415

def cut(num,c):

  c = 10 **c

  return int(int*c)/c

cut(num,3)

可以试一下 猴子选大王,PYTHON 问题解答

一群猴子要选新猴王。新猴王的选择方法是:让N只候选猴子围成一圈,从某位置起顺序编号为1~N号。从第1号开始报数,每轮从1报到3,凡报到3的猴子即退出圈子,接着又从紧邻的下一只猴子开始同样的报数。如此不断循环,最后剩下的一只猴子就选为猴王。请问是原来第几号猴子当选猴王?

入格式:

输入在一行中给一个正整数N(≤1000)

出格式:

在一行中输出当选猴王的编号

需要两个 计数器: 每次数到第几只猴踢出去的次数统计 ,和 剩下数量SHU数统计

需要一个while 递归 不断自己调用自己 ,然后数 到第几只 踢出去 ,再把剩下的调用自己 重来一次,再踢出去

循环 , while ,for in  , 其中 for in 循环  continue  结束本次循环  break 终止循环

原文地址:https://www.cnblogs.com/xred/p/13079998.html